- Staged rollout buckets reduced from 10% to 5% initial cohort after the Kestrel-board brownout report.
- Manifest signatures now verified before download, not after.
- Rollback images retained for two prior releases instead of one.
- Delta updates skipped automatically when flash wear exceeds threshold.
- Channel pinning persists across factory reset on Larkspur hardware.

Reviewers should confirm the signature-verification ordering change against the threat model notes. The engineer accountable for this release is named below.

account owner for fawig-tahag: Zorath Briwyn

## Authentication

If your plugin hooks into the StockSquare reconciliation job, it needs to call our internal ledger service, and that means bringing a key along. Plugins without one get rejected before the first batch runs, no exceptions. Pop it into your plugin config under the auth section. The key to use is below.

app token of hahig-yawip = zpat11_7vvKNZ1kAOl

### v2.14.1 — Report export timezone fix

Scheduled exports from Ledgermark previously rendered timestamps in server-local time regardless of workspace settings, causing day-boundary misalignment in daily summaries. Exports now resolve the workspace timezone at generation time, with DST transitions handled explicitly. Existing archived exports are unaffected. The engineer accountable for this change is listed below.

named custodian: Oliath Ralax